Berliet ended up being a French manufacturer regarding automobiles, buses, trucks and military motor vehicles among other vehicles located in Vénissieux, outside of Lyon, France. Founded in 1899, and apart from some sort of five-year period from 1944 to 1949 when it was put into 'administration sequestre' it absolutely was in private ownership until 1967 when after that it became part of Citroën, and subsequently acquired through Renault in 1974 as well as merged with Saviem into a new Renault Trucks organization in 1978. The Berliet marque was eliminated by 1980.Marius Berliet started his experiments with automobiles in 1894. Some single-cylinder cars were being followed in 1900 by a twin-cylinder model. In 1902, Berliet took over the actual plant of Audibert & Lavirotte in Lyon. Berliet started to create four-cylinder automobiles featured by way of a honeycomb radiator and aluminum chassis frame was used rather then wood. The next year, a model was launched that has been similar to contemporary Mercedes. In 1906, Berliet sold the driver's licence for manufacturing his model to the American Locomotive Company.

Just before World War I, Berliet offered a range of models from 8 CV to 60 CV. The main models got four-cylinder engines (2412 cc and 4398 cc, respectively), and there was a six-cylinder model of 9500 cc. A 1539 cc model (12 CV) ended up being produced between 1910 in addition to 1912. From 1912, six-cylinder models were created upon individual orders simply.The First World War resulted in a massive increase in demand. Berliet, like Renault and Latil, produced trucks for this French army. The military orders placed major demands within the factory's capacity, necessitating major investment inside production plant and manufacturing area space.In 1915 a 500 hectare site was ordered between Vénissieux et Saint-Priest to be able to build a new main factory.The Berliet CBA evolved into the iconic truck around the Voie Sacrée, supplying the battle entrance at Verdun during 1916. 25, 000 of these 4/5 lot Berliet trucks, originally launched in 1914, were ordered by this French army. During 1916 40 of which were leaving the plant everyday. Under license from Renault, Berliet were also generating shells and battle tanks presently. The number of staff employed increased to 3, 150.By 1917 the importance of annual turnover received multiplied fourfold since the start of the war, and a new legitimate structure was deemed correct. The company became the particular Société anonyme des Automobiles Marius Berliet.As soon as the war the manufacturer reoriented part of its production back to be able to passenger cars, but Berliet nevertheless observed themselves with excess ability, as the army was no longer buying all the pickup trucks the factory could produce, and overall output halved.Marius Berliet responded towards the outbreak of peace by deciding to generate just a single form of truck and a single type of car, which represented a travel from his pre-war market strategy. The single truck where Berliet focused was the particular 5 ton CBA that had served the united states so well during this war.

The passenger car to get produced, exhibited on the Berliet stand for the 15th Paris Motor Demonstrate in October 1919, was the 3296cc (15HP/CV) "Torpedo" bodied "Berliet Sort VB" of modern look. Marius Berliet was not just one to miss a technique: rather than devote time and engineering talent to having a new car for the revolutionary decade, he obtained and duplicated an American Dodge. The Dodge was famously robust, and the Berliet backup was well received in March 1919 when the item had its first open outing, locally, at the Lyon Business Fair. The headlights were mounted unusually high and also the simple disc wheels had been large, giving the car a nice "no nonsense" look. Particularly attractive was the price of just 11, 800 francs in Oct 1919. Unfortunately, however, the Berliet engineers failed to make certain the steel used inside the car's construction was on the same quality as the American steel used for your Dodge, and this resulted in series problems for the early customers of this "Berliet Type VB" and serious reputational destruction of the company.

The factory ended up set up to create the "Berliet Type VB" for the rate of 100 cars every day which would have already been an ambitious target under any circumstances. The rapid drop-off popular for what at this point was the manufacturer's merely passenger car model that followed the high quality issues plunged the company into financial difficulties, with losses of fityfive million francs recorded a single year. Survival was in question, and Berliet was placed in judicial administration in 1921. Marius Berliet himself had held 88% from the share capital, but was unable to pay off all the company's creditors and the firm therefore fell to the hands of the banking institutions. Berliet was nevertheless capable to retain operational control. During the ensuring several years, supported by a sustained recovery successful that in turn reflected a highly effective model strategy after 1922, Berliet was able in order to his debtors and, in 1929, to regain financial control above the business from the financial institutions.
